LOS ANGELES – Ph.D. candidate Nicholas Vakkur sued the Pardee Rand Graduate School and Rand Corp., claiming they rejected his thesis and gave him the boot because the thesis portrayed the Sarbanes-Oxley Act unfavorably, and former SEC Chairman Arthur Levitt, a backer of the law, is a major contributor to Rand, and a member of Vakkur’s thesis committee “aggressively promoted” the law too.
